How do I confirm my wood fire starter supplier meets fire safety and compliance standards before a trade show?
A German distributor once called us two weeks before a Cologne show. His pompier 2 wanted proof his display stock was safe. His previous supplier had no paperwork at all.
Ask your supplier for SGS or Intertek test reports, Safety Data Sheets, ISO 9001 certification, and written confirmation of composition, such as wood fiber and paraffin ratios. Verify certificate numbers directly with the testing body, and confirm the documents match the exact SKU you will display.

Paperwork is the foundation of every safe display plan. Trade show enforcement now runs on documentation, not good intentions. A fire marshal does not care what your supplier told you on a call. He cares about what you can show him on paper, on site, before the doors open.

The documents that matter most
Not all paperwork carries equal weight with venue inspectors. Here is how I rank the requests we see:
| Document | Ce qu'elle prouve | When the venue asks for it |
|---|---|---|
| Fiches de données de sécurité (FDS) | Flashpoint, hazard classification, handling rules | Almost always for ignitable products |
| Rapports de test SGS/Intertek | Product performance and safety testing | During floor-plan or booth review |
| Certificats ISO 9001 / BSCI | Consistent production and ethical factories | Buyer due diligence, some organizers |
| Déclaration de composition | Exact de la fibre de bois et de la paraffine 4 ratio | Hazardous materials handling 5 review |
| Flame-retardancy certificates | Booth fixtures and fabrics meet NFPA 701 | Booth construction inspection |
Verify before you ship
Do not stop at receiving PDFs. Check the certificate numbers with the issuing lab. Confirm the report covers your exact product, not a similar SKU. Ask whether the report is current, because some venues reject documents older than a few years. Finally, confirm your product liability insurance covers exhibition display, because some organizers ask for that too. A ten-minute risk assessment call with your supplier before shipping beats a panicked call from the show floor.
What display packaging options can my supplier offer to keep wood fire starters safe and appealing on the show floor?
On our production line, we run a full display packaging workshop beside the wax-dipping stations. That setup exists because retail buyers kept asking for shelf-ready boxes, not loose cartons.
A capable supplier can provide retail display boxes, acrylic-shielded bins, counter display units, inert display replicas, and fire-retardant secondary packaging. These options separate the visual sample from bulk stock, reduce the exposed fire load, and keep the booth attractive without violating venue fire codes.

Packaging is where exhibition booth compliance and merchandising meet. Wax-dipped wood rolls look wonderful stacked in an open crate. They also look like a fuel pile to an inspector. The solution is not to hide the product. It is to package it so only a controlled amount is exposed at once.

Options to discuss with your supplier
| Packaging option | Safety benefit | Visual benefit |
|---|---|---|
| Sealed retail boxes | Contains wax and fiber, limits exposure | Full branding surface, clean shelf look |
| Acrylic-shielded bins | Physical barrier from lighting and electronics | Product remains visible and touchable-looking |
| Counter display units | Caps quantity staged per unit | Organized, professional presentation |
| Inert display replicas | Zero flammability, resin or treated composite | Perfect texture and color, no restrictions |
| Fire-retardant secondary packaging | Treated coatings lower ignition risk | May allow more visible inventory |
Match the packaging to booth zones
Think in zones. Put inert replicas or sealed boxes at the front, where visitors touch things. Keep shielded bins in the middle, away from display lighting hot spots. Store reserve cartons off-site or in approved combustible material storage areas the venue provides. We also recommend a quick heat check during setup. Halogen spotlights get hot, and untreated wood-wool starters should never sit directly under them. Fire retardant materials in your fixtures, plus smart zoning, keep both the inspector and your booth designer happy.
How can I coordinate with my supplier on warning labels and safety documentation for trade show display units?
There is a real trade-off I weigh on every private-label order: a busy warning label protects everyone legally, but it can crowd out the branding a buyer paid for. The answer is planning both together, early.
Send your supplier the venue's exhibitor manual and your market's labeling rules before printing. Agree on warning text, hazard symbols, barcodes, and language versions, then have the supplier print compliant labels on every display unit and ship a matching documentation set with the goods.

Labels and documents are two halves of the same job. The label tells a visitor and an inspector what the product is. The documentation proves the label is accurate. When they disagree, you have a problem at inspection time.

For fire starters, typical elements include keep-away-from-children warnings, flammability notices 6, usage instructions, and composition details such as 50% wood fiber and 50% paraffin. For trade show display units specifically, we add batch numbers so any unit on the floor traces back to a tested production run.
A practical coordination sequence
- You send the exhibitor manual and target-market labeling rules to the supplier.
- The supplier drafts label artwork with warnings, symbols, and barcodes placed around your branding.
- You review a digital proof and confirm language versions.
- The supplier prints labels during production, not after, so every display unit ships compliant.
- The supplier prepares a documentation set: SDS, test reports, composition statement, and a signed retardancy letter for fixtures.
- You assemble an on-site compliance binder and keep a digital backup on your phone.
This sequence usually takes two to three weeks. The binder step matters most. Fire safety regulations are enforced by people, and people respond well to organized, immediate answers. When an inspector asks a question and you open a tabbed binder to the exact page, the conversation gets short and friendly. When you promise to email something later, it gets long.
What lead times should I plan with my supplier for custom display samples ahead of a trade show?
A lesson from 17 years of export orders: the buyers who panic before shows are almost never the ones with product problems. They are the ones who started sampling six weeks out instead of twelve.
Plan 8–12 weeks total: 1–2 weeks for design confirmation, 2–3 weeks for custom display samples, 1–2 weeks for shipping and your review, then 3–4 weeks of buffer for revisions, documentation, and freight to the venue. Compress this only for repeat designs.

Lead time is where good display plans quietly fail. A custom counter display unit is not just a box. It involves structural dieline design 7, print proofing, sometimes fire-retardant coating, and coordination with the product inside it. Each step has a queue at the factory, and each revision restarts part of that queue.

Why the buffer is not optional
Trade shows have fixed dates. Factories, freight lines, and customs do not always cooperate with fixed dates. We build our production schedule so that first samples reliably reflect mass-production quality, which removes one common source of delay. But we still tell every buyer to protect a three-week buffer. Venue floor-plan approval can come back with change requests. A fire marshal may ask for an extra retardancy treatment on a fixture. Customs can hold wax-based products for classification questions under hazardous materials handling rules, even when the goods are fully compliant. None of these are disasters at twelve weeks out. All of them are disasters at four. Start early, confirm in writing, and let the calendar work for you instead of against you.
